Note: You need an unencrypted configuration file for this feature. Also the default files, image.out and system.conf, must be in the root directory of the USB key.

Note: Make sure at least FortiOS v3.0MR1 is installed on the FortiGate unit before installing.

To configure the USB Auto-Install

1Go to System > Maintenance > Backup and Restore.

2Select the blue arrow to expand the Advanced options.

3Select the following:

On system restart, automatically update FortiGate configuration file if default file name is available on the USB disk.

On system restart, automatically update FortiGate firmware image if default image is available on the USB disk.

4Enter the configuration and image file names or use the default configuration filename (system.conf) and default image name (image.out).

5The default configuration filename should show in the Default configuration file name field.

6Select Apply.

Using the CLI

Installing firmware replaces your current antivirus and attack definitions, along with the definitions included with the firmware release you are installing. After you install new firmware, make sure that antivirus and attack definitions are up to date. You can also use the CLI command execute update-nowto update the antivirus and attack definitions. For details, see the FortiGate Administration Guide.

Before you begin, ensure you have a TFTP server running and accessible to the FortiGate unit.

To upgrade the firmware using the CLI

1Make sure the TFTP server is running.

2Copy the new firmware image file to the root directory of the TFTP server.

3Log into the CLI.

4Make sure the FortiGate unit can connect to the TFTP server.

You can use the following command to ping the computer running the TFTP server. For example, if the IP address of the TFTP server is 192.168.1.168:

execute ping 192.168.1.168

The Fortinet 620B is a state-of-the-art security appliance designed to provide comprehensive cybersecurity solutions for medium to large enterprises. As part of Fortinet's FortiGate series, the 620B combines advanced security features with robust performance capabilities, ensuring that organizations can protect their networks against an evolving threat landscape.

One of the standout features of the Fortinet 620B is its exceptional threat protection capabilities. The device utilizes Fortinet's proprietary FortiOS operating system, which integrates multiple security functions, including firewall, intrusion prevention system (IPS), virtual private network (VPN), and antivirus. This unified approach enables organizations to enforce consistent security policies across their network without compromising performance.

The FortiGate 620B is powered by Fortinet's purpose-built security processing unit (SPU) architecture, which significantly accelerates threat detection and mitigation processes. With multi-core processing capabilities, the device can handle high volumes of traffic while maintaining low latency, making it suitable for environments with heavy data flows. This performance is critical for organizations requiring real-time inspection of encrypted traffic, as the 620B offers strong decryption capabilities without sacrificing throughput.

In addition to its security features, the Fortinet 620B includes advanced networking technologies. The device supports software-defined networking (SDN) and integrates with Fortinet’s Security Fabric, allowing for enhanced visibility and control across the entire network ecosystem. This fabric architecture enables seamless communication between multiple devices, streamlining the management of security policies and improving overall network efficiency.

Another key characteristic of the FortiGate 620B is its scalability. Organizations can easily scale their deployment to meet growing demands by utilizing additional Fortinet appliances and services. The device also provides extensive reporting and analytics features, offering insights into network usage and security incidents, empowering security teams to make informed decisions.
